Angry Chankast Won't Boot Games

I'm running Windows 2000 and Windows XP 64-bit Edition. Neither of these OSes boot games. I know what I have works because it boots fine on my dad's Windows XP computer. I tried copying a few dlls but after some disassembling, cd_rom.dll seems to pose a problem: it imports from kernel32.dll.
